【Design Thinking 1 day Workshop - co-organized by Tokyo Tech and Hitotsubashi Univ./Call for students】

1-IMG_2807Pano_L.jpg


The process of 5 steps of Design Thinking, which has been focused in d.school, Stanford University, will be experienced and executed in 5 hours. Design Thinking is the concept for innovators by not aggregation of knowledge but also idea generation without prejudice, and exploring potential "needs" by presenting prototypes, which may be resulted to "innovation".

This time, the workshop will be held in Kunitachi-east campus, Hitotsubashi Univ. and students from both Tokyo Tech and Hitotsubashi will be expected as participants to this workshop (language; Japanese) .
